EFFECT OF WALL HEATING ON THE CHARACTERISTICS OF NEAR-WALL REVERSE FLOW EVENTS OCCURRING IN A TURBULENT DUCT

Abstract

Direct numerical simulation is used to study the effect of wall heating on the characteristics of a near-wall reverse flow during a turbulent stream of various coolants in a duct. A temperature field is considered both in a passive scalar approximation and in a low Mach number approximation. Qualitative and quantitative results are obtained that characterize the probability of occurrence of a near-wall reverse flow in all the cases considered at a Reynolds number  \(\mathrm{Re}= 3150\)  based on mean flow velocity and duct half-height. It is revealed that, in the cases considered, the wall heating causes a two- or a threefold increase in the probability of near-wall reverse flow formation .
